Finite Element Analysis Software | Autodesk Finite element analysis (FEA) is a computerized method for predicting how a product reacts to real world forces, vibration, heat, fluid flow, and other physical effects. Finite element analysis shows whether a product will break, wear out, or work the way it was designed. The relationship between estimated bone strength by finite ... Finite element method Wikipedia The extended finite element method (XFEM) is a numerical technique based on the generalized finite element method (GFEM) and the partition of unity method (PUM). It extends the classical finite element method by enriching the solution space for solutions to differential equations with discontinuous functions.
